### CI Note: Invoice Renderer Flake

The Quillbox PDF invoice renderer has been failing intermittently on the CI render-diff stage. Root cause appears to be a font cache that isn't warmed on fresh runners, producing one-pixel kerning differences that trip the comparison threshold. We've added a warm-up step and loosened the diff tolerance slightly; three consecutive green runs since. If it regresses, rerun with the cache step disabled to confirm. The candidate we're proposing for promotion is identified by the token below.

pipeline stamp: htk9_ce63042d9

Handover Note — Annual Billing Switch

Welcome aboard! The big item in flight is moving Brightquill customers from monthly to annual billing. Uptake is around 40% so far, and finance loves the cash-flow bump. Keep an eye on churn in the Fernwood segment — it's twitchy. For context, here's the confidential piece you should read first.

confidential, kagap-kajeg: Istethax Holdings is in early talks to buy Ulaielix Works for about $23.7 million. The Lamys launch date is July 6, and nothing goes to the press before then.

- [ ] **Step 7: Breaker override escrow.** After sealing the signing keys for the Tallgrove upstream API circuit breaker, confirm the support team can force the breaker open during a full outage. The override bundle lives in the sealed escrow drawer and is useless without its unlock phrase. Two ceremony witnesses must initial this step before proceeding. The escrow bundle is decrypted with the recovery passphrase that follows.

vault phrase of kahip-kahop = holath-quenmir

Action item (PM-214, Gellhorn exports incident): all report export timestamps were rendered in server-local time for the Ostwick region, shifting daily totals by one day. Fix: exports must take an explicit timezone parameter and default to the account's configured zone, never the host zone. Release manager to block any export-service release until the regression test covering DST boundaries passes in the Pellan staging suite. Verification checklist, affected report types, and rollback criteria are listed on the internal page here.

operations page: https://jira.qorvelsys.internal/browse/pages/browse/pages